Downhill Battle

Downhill Battle is a non-profit organization whose goal is to end the Big Four recording labels monopoly and build a fairer music industry. The group supports what they call "participatory culture" where everyone is a part of creating and sharing art and music.

Downhill Battle believes that the four major record labels have a monopoly that is bad for both musicians and music culture, but they also believe that they have an opportunity to change that. They also believe that they can use tools like filesharing to strengthen the role of independent record labels in the music industry.

They are also known for their projects such as Grey Tuesday, Banned Music , FreeCulture.org , Peer-to-Peer Legal Defense Fund , SueThePresident.com and more.
